Typical Cashier Pitfalls and How to Sidestep Them
Even a well-designed cashier can pose stumbling blocks if a player is not familiar with a few recurring issues. One of the most typical is attempting to withdraw to a method that has not been utilized for a deposit. Maxbet Casino, like the majority of regulated operators, enforces a closed-loop policy that requires withdrawals to go back to the originating deposit method where possible. A player who made a deposit with a debit card but then attempts to cash out to an e-wallet will see the request declined. The fix is straightforward: always review the available withdrawal methods in the cashier before requesting a payout, and if necessary, place a small deposit with the desired withdrawal method first.
Another common pitfall concerns bonus funds and the associated wagering requirements. Players sometimes see a large total balance in the cashier and assume the entire amount is withdrawable, only to discover that a significant portion is locked bonus money. Trying to withdraw while an active bonus is still under wagering can lead to the forfeiture of the bonus and any winnings obtained from it. The cashier displays the split between cash and bonus balances, but it is the player’s duty to comprehend the terms. Reading the bonus policy and completing wagering before making a withdrawal is the safest approach.

Cashing Out Winnings: A Step-by-Step Guide
Initiating a withdrawal at Maxbet Casino follows a logical sequence that prioritises security and regulatory compliance. The player begins by opening the cashier and switching to the Withdraw tab. The system then presents the payment methods, which are typically limited to those used earlier for deposits, a rule called closed-loop processing that aids in preventing money laundering. If the player deposited with multiple methods, the cashier may demand withdrawals to be sent back to each method in relation to the deposits made, with any leftover amount sent to a main method such as a bank account. This is common practice across UK-facing casinos and is not specific to Maxbet.
After selecting a method and entering the withdrawal amount, the player sends the request. The cashier then puts the withdrawal into a review queue, where it goes through an internal review. During this pending period, which can last from a few hours up to 48 hours, the player still has the option to reverse the withdrawal and return the funds to their gaming balance. This function is a mixed blessing; it offers flexibility for those who reconsider, but it can also encourage players to void cashouts without thinking. Once the pending period concludes and the withdrawal is approved, the funds are disbursed to the payment provider, and the processing time depends on the method picked.
Comprehending Withdrawal Timelines
E-wallet withdrawals are the quickest, often hitting the player’s Skrill or Neteller account within 24 hours of approval, and occasionally much sooner. Debit card withdrawals take additional time, typically two to five business days, because they must pass through the card network’s settlement process. Bank transfers sit at the slower end of the spectrum, with delivery times of three to seven business days being typical. These estimates are not promises but realistic averages based on standard banking infrastructure. Maxbet Casino’s cashier displays the expected timeframe for each method at the point of withdrawal, so players can plan accordingly.
Several factors can prolong these timeframes. A first withdrawal almost always takes longer because it activates a manual KYC review if documents have not already been approved. Large withdrawals above a certain threshold may also require additional compliance checks. Weekends and public holidays can add a day or two, as banks do not process transactions on non-business days. Players can reduce delays by ensuring their account is fully verified before requesting a payout, by choosing e-wallets when speed is a priority, and by avoiding the reverse withdrawal button unless they genuinely plan to continue playing.

Deposit Caps and Self-Banning
Responsible gambling tools are embedded within the cashier, ensuring they are readily available at the moment they matter most. Users can configure daily, weekly or monthly deposit limits that the system enforces automatically; once a limit is reached, the cashier will decline further deposits until the period resets. These limits can be lowered at once, though requests to expand or eliminate them usually include a cooling-off period of 24 hours or more, a purposeful feature that prevents impulsive decisions. The cashier also links to reality check timers and session loss limits, which can be adjusted from the same responsible gaming panel.
For those who require a more permanent pause, self-exclusion options are accessible directly through the account settings, with the cashier playing a supporting role by preventing all transactions for the duration of the exclusion period. Maxbet Casino commonly presents exclusions spanning from six months to five years, and during that time the player is unable to deposit, withdraw or access the gaming lobby. The cashier will show a clear message if a self-excluded user tries to log in and fund their account, eliminating any confusion. These tools are not buried in the fine print; they are presented as part of the standard account management flow, showing a genuine commitment to player welfare.
Payment Method Information: Card Options, E-Wallets and Bank Transfers
Debit card transactions remain the foundation of online casino transactions in the UK, and Maxbet Casino offers both Visa and Mastercard for deposits and withdrawals. The key benefit is ease; most adults already possesses a compatible card, and the deposit process reflects typical e-commerce. On the payout side, card payouts are reliable but not the fastest, and certain banks may flag gambling transactions, occasionally causing a hold-up while the bank conducts its own security checks. Card users should also be aware that, since April 2020, UK laws prohibit the use of credit cards for online gambling, so just debit cards connected to a current account are permitted.
E-wallets such as Skrill and Neteller offer a attractive alternative by placing between the player’s bank and the casino. Deposits are instant, and cash-outs are reliably speedier than card or bank transfer choices, often arriving within hours of clearance. The downside is that some casino bonuses may exclude e-wallet deposits, so players who intend to secure a welcome bonus must check the terms closely. Furthermore, e-wallet companies may charge their own charges for currency conversion or withdrawals to a bank account, however transfers to and from Maxbet Casino directly are normally free on the casino’s side. For those who prioritize speed and confidentiality, e-wallets are the best option.
Bank Wires and Prepaid Methods
Bank transfer is the standard method for transferring larger sums, and it attracts high rollers who may surpass the transaction limits of cards or e-wallets. The process demands the player to initiate a transfer from their online banking portal using the casino’s bank details, which the cashier offers. Because the funds must go through the banking system, deposits are not instant and can take one to three working days to appear. Withdrawals via bank transfer are equally slow but deliver the highest level of security for substantial amounts. Maxbet Casino does not usually charge for bank transfers, but the sending and receiving banks may apply fees, so it is wise to check beforehand.
Paysafecard and other prepaid vouchers fulfill a niche but important role for players who wish to deposit without sharing any bank or card details. A voucher is purchased with cash or online, and the 16-digit PIN is typed into the cashier to credit the account instantly. The limitation is that prepaid cards are deposit-only; winnings must be taken out through an alternative method such as bank transfer. This renders them ideal for controlling spend, because the player can only deposit the value of the voucher they have purchased. Maxbet Casino’s cashier clearly marks Paysafecard as a deposit-only method, so there is no confusion when it is time to cash out.
